Oceanfront luxury and comfort await at this 1 Bedroom 3rd-floor condo. This condo has 2 queen beds and 1 Murphy bed, flat-screen TVs, and a private balcony that has a direct ocean view. This 3rd-floor condo sleeps up to six guests in one bedroom with 2 queens and a Murphy bed in the living area. The bedroom is furnished with 2 queen beds and 2 HDTVs, while the bathroom has a tub/shower combination. The main living area has a 65" flat-screen TV and a DVD player. Slide open the glass doors to your private balcony and relax to the calming sounds of the ocean.
Abundant amenities await you at this beachfront resort. Features include both indoor and outdoor whirlpools, a lazy river ride, a cavernous pool deck, and social areas, Oceanfront pools. Kids's Interactive splash and play area. AND BEST OF ALL COMPLIMENTARY WIFI!
Conveniently located and within steps of the beach, close to Family Kingdom Amusement Park. A short drive from Broadway at the Beach, Market Common, Ripley's Aquarium, and IMAX Theater. Many of the area's trendy attractions, eateries, golf courses, and shopping are a short drive away.
This beachfront condo features 2 Queen Beds and 1 Murfpy bed, a private bathroom, full-sized appliances, and a kitchen table. This beachfront condo sleeps 6. Appreciate the morning sunrise on your private oceanfront balcony overlooking the charming ocean.

Tips to get the optimal rental experience:
Getting the most from your vacation rental budget:
- Summertime is high season in Myrtle Beach. Reserve your vacation in Spring or Fall to get the benefit of gorgeous we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ities.
- In the Myrtle Beach area, The earlier your group can reserve a vacation rental, the better your selection will be. The most desirable rental homes are reserved very early. Booking your rental home up to twelve months before your travel dates is recommended. Winter holidays are excellent times to search for and book your rental property.
-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ective vacation rental company or host whether your vacationing group qualifies for a special promotion or discount.
- Booking websites frequently offer customers an option to obtain tr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which costs 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ed time as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for additional information.
- Look for your local Myrtle Beach visitors guide magazine upon arrival. If your rental home do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local shops and fuel stations. In addition to great local information, visitor guides have coupons for nearby accommodations and attractions.

Advice for a smooth stay:
- Get the property manager's phone number and check in/check out procedures for your rental property.
- To ensure that damages are not attributed to your stay, record any problem areas during arrival. E-mail the host right away to relay any issues. If there is a dispute about legal responsibility later, having the recorded problems and contact attempts will be valuable.
- Hosts are there to help! Don't be shy to ask questions during your stay.
-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like unpleasant vacationers disrupting your peace and quiet. Practice the golden rule for common sense. Happy residents may even recommend great beaches and places you would've never otherwise known!
-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local! Neighbors can typically point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to go for the best drinks,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for bird watching?
- Protect the rental owner (and your stuff!) by keeping the rental locked up while you are away, just like you would at home.
- Re-check every room of the vacation property to confirm that you've packed everything at departure. Re-check dressers, closets, and bathrooms for hidden items.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Record a video to document the condition of the property.
- Did you have a fantastic time? Most rental websites make it easy for clients to provide feedback. If your property and/or host was wonderful, they always love to hear your praise. If anything was inoperable and they failed to address it reasonably, or if the vacation rental wasn't described correctly, you'll want to make a note as part of your comments.
